Submitting an accident claim can be a challenging process for victims. Below is a detailed guide to help individuals understand what to anticipate when pursuing a claim:

Consultation: Victims must arrange a consultation with an Accident Injury Lawsuit Attorney case attorney to talk about the specifics of their case. During this preliminary conference, the attorney will assess the circumstance and figure out whether there is a legitimate claim.

Examination: If the case continues, the attorney will perform a thorough examination, gathering evidence such as authorities reports, medical records, and witness declarations.

Settlement: The attorney will often take part in negotiations with the insurance provider to look for a reasonable settlement for the victim. This stage may include back-and-forth discussions to get to an acceptable amount.

Submitting a Lawsuit: If settlements fail, the attorney may suggest submitting a lawsuit. This involves preparing legal documents and submitting them to the proper court.

Discovery Phase: Both celebrations exchange proof and gather information appropriate to the case throughout this phase. This can include depositions, interrogatories, and requests for files.

Trial: If the case does not settle, it might go to trial, where both sides will provide their arguments before a judge or jury.

Settlement or Verdict: After trial, the jury will render a decision, or the parties might reach a settlement before reaching this phase.

1. How do I know if I have a valid case?
A legitimate case normally includes showing that another celebration's carelessness triggered your injuries. Consulting with an experienced accident case attorney can assist clarify this.
2. What if the accident was partly my fault?
In numerous jurisdictions, you can still recover damages even if you share some obligation. Nevertheless, your compensation might be decreased based on your percentage of fault.
3. How long do I have to sue?
The statute of limitations for filing an Top Accident Attorney claim varies by state and kind of accident, however it normally ranges from one to 6 years.
4. What types of damages can I recuperate?
Victims may be entitled to various damages, including medical costs,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age.
5. Will my case go to trial?
Not all cases go to trial. Many settle during settlements, but having actually an attorney prepared for trial can strengthen your position during settlement discussions.
